Clearfield Broadens National Account Focus

Clearfield, Inc. (NASDAQ: CLFD), the specialist in fiber management and connectivity platforms for communications providers, today announced that Kevin Craddock has joined the company as national account manager for AT&T. A seasoned sales leader, Kevin brings over 20 years of experience to Clearfield having established strong relationships throughout his career focused on key service providers in telecommunications.

Kevin has held a wide variety of positions, from sales engineer to Senior Director of Sales, garnering extensive experience with AT&T. His experience began with Southwestern Bell and most recently included oversight of an AT&T account. Previously, he held sales roles at Charles Industries, Corning Cable Systems, Emerson Network Power, RELTEC/Marconi and Suttle. Kevin holds a bachelor’s degree in business from the University of Texas at Arlington.

“We are truly excited to welcome Kevin to our team,” said Brian Shane, Director of National Accounts for Clearfield. “His track record and years of experience addressing the needs of service providers will certainly further our commitment to growing and supporting the opportunities available to us within the Tier 1 wireless and wireline markets.”

“The service provider access networks embrace fiber to support gigabit services, and with wireless developments like 5G, operators such as AT&T are leading the industry,” commented Craddock. “I’ve dealt with Clearfield in the past and know the value they bring to the physical access fiber marketplace. With their forward-looking products, Clearfield is uniquely suited to bring flexible, high-density, lower TCO products to market that allow providers like AT&T to successfully navigate 5G and the future.”

About Clearfield

Clearfield, Inc. (NASDAQ: CLFD) designs, manufactures and distributes fiber optic management, protection and delivery products for communications networks. Our “fiber to the anywhere” platform serves the unique requirements of leading incumbent local exchange carriers (ILECS), competitive local exchange carriers (CLECs), Wireless operators, and MSO/cable TV companies, while also catering to the broadband needs of the utility/municipality, enterprise, data center and military markets. Headquartered in Minneapolis, MN, Clearfield deploys more than a million fiber ports each year.
